Popular Libraries for Data Extraction
In the realm of web scraping, libraries such as Beautiful Soup and Scrapy stand out as industry favorites. Beautiful Soup is renowned for its user-friendly interface, making it accessible even for those new to coding. It simplifies the process of navigating nested HTML tags, allowing users to extract specific data points quickly. This library is particularly useful for smaller projects or when one needs to scrape data from simple websites.
On the other hand, the Scrapy library is a robust framework that provides a more comprehensive solution for larger scraping tasks. It allows for the development of spider-like bots that can crawl multiple pages and handle a vast amount of data simultaneously. By mastering these libraries, users can unlock the full potential of web scraping and automate their data extraction workflows seamlessly.
Ethical Web Scraping Practices
While web scraping can offer several benefits, it is essential to adhere to ethical practices to ensure that the process respects the rights of website owners. Ethical web scraping involves understanding and following the rules set forth in a site’s robots.txt file, which indicates which parts of the site can be scraped. Additionally, respecting website terms of service is crucial to avoid legal issues. Ethical practices promote a healthy relationship between data gatherers and website operators.
Moreover, ethical web scraping entails conducting data extraction in a manner that does not harm the target website’s performance. For example, it is advisable to implement delays between requests to minimize server load. By ensuring that scraping activities are timed appropriately and aligned with ethical standards, one can effectively utilize data scraping applications without causing potential disruptions or legal repercussions.

The Role of Robots.txt in Scraping
The robots.txt file plays a vital role in web scraping as it serves as a guideline for web crawlers about which parts of a site can be accessed. This file helps webmasters manage the behavior of search engines and scrapers, indicating which pages they should or should not visit. For anyone involved in web scraping, it is crucial to review the robots.txt file of a target site before initiating a scraping project to understand the permissible boundaries.
Ignoring the directives in the robots.txt file can lead to ethical breaches and potential legal consequences. Moreover, it demonstrates a lack of respect for the website’s management. Hence, adhering to these guidelines not only supports ethical scraping practices but also fosters goodwill between data harvesters and website owners, ensuring a more sustainable approach to data extraction.
Enhancing Data Scraping with Automation
Automation significantly enhances the efficiency of data scraping processes, allowing users to scale their data extraction efforts without involving more manual labor. By automating scraping tasks with tools like Scrapy, users can write scripts that automatically navigate to the relevant web pages, extract the necessary data, and store it in preferred formats, such as CSV or JSON. This automation reduces human error and increases the volume of data that can be collected within a given time frame.
Moreover, incorporating automation into data scraping practices allows for the continuous monitoring of websites for changes. This capability is particularly useful for industries that rely on real-time data, such as e-commerce, where price updates and product availability fluctuate frequently. By setting up automated scraping systems, businesses can maintain a competitive edge by quickly adapting to market changes.
